" WE ARE ACTING FOR THE MORTGAGEES AND HAVE RECEIVED AN OFFER OF ยฃ78,000 ON THE ABOVE PROPERTY. ANY INTERESTED PARTIES MUST SUBMIT ANY HIGHER OFFERS IN WRITING TO THE SELLING AGENT BEFORE AN EXCHANGE OF CONTRACTS TAKES PLACE.
This mid terrace house is in need of updating and may well appeal to investors, and has the benefit of no onward chain. In brief the property comprises of a lounge, dining kitchen ( only fitted with a sink, no units ), two double bedrooms and a bathroom. There is some double glazing and electric storage heaters. To the front and rear are lawned gardens in need of attention with access gained via a shared passageway.

? Mid terraced house in need of upgrading
? Lounge & dining kitchen
? Two double bedrooms and family bathroom
? Gardens to the front and rear
? No onward chain


Lounge 13'2" x 12'3" (4.01m x 3.73m). Double glazed window to the front, raised plinth fireplace with a coal effect gas fire, double opening doors leading through to the dining/kitchen.

Dining/ Kitchen 15'11" x 15'1" (4.85m x 4.6m). This room does not have any fitted units and comprises only of a sink unit with space for washing machine, laminate effect flooring, under stairs storage, electric storage heater, two double glazed windows to the rear and door giving access to the garden.

Bedroom One 13'2" (4.01m) x 8'10" (2.7m) (plus 6'8" (2.03m) x 8'7" (2.62m)). This irregular shaped room incorporates a storage area and has two windows to the front and a electric storage heater.

Bedroom Two 10'10" x 8'9" (3.3m x 2.67m). Double glazed window to the rear and electric storage heater.

Bathroom 7'6" x 6'4" (2.29m x 1.93m). Double glazed obscure window to the rear, low level WC, pedestal wash hand basin, bath with electric shower, tiled floor and walls and heated towel rail.

Front    To the front of the property there is a shared access pathway leading on to the shared passage way giving access to the rear and a lawned garden.

Rear    To the rear of the property there is a rear garden which is need of maintenance and includes a detached garage with access to a service road.
